Your Trash Can's Best Friend: Bin Cleaning Tips and Tricks

Let's face it, cleaning the trash can aint exactly on anyone's top list. But keeping your bin clean is crucial for preventing nasty odors and bacteria. Don't worry, though! Cleaning your trash can doesn't have to be a horrible experience. With these straightforward tips and tricks, you can make it a breeze.

Start by removing the trash and giving the bin a good rinse with hot water and detergent. For tougher grime, try using a mixture of baking soda and vinegar. Let it sit for a few minutes, then scrub with a brush.

Clean the bin thoroughly and let it air dry completely before putting in fresh trash bags. You can also add a few drops of essential oil to your cleaning solution for a pleasant scent.

And remember, regular cleaning is key! Aim to clean your trash can at least once a month.

Banish Bad Odors: How to Purge Your Bin Effectively

Getting rid of that nasty smell coming from your bin can be a real chore. Luckily, it doesn't have to be a battle you lose! With a few simple tricks and the right supplies, you can conquer even the most stubborn odors and keep your kitchen smelling fresh.

First things first, don't ignore regular cleaning. Aim for at least once a week to prevent odors from building up in the first place.

Pull out the trash regularly and give the bin a quick wipe with hot water and dishwashing liquid.

For a deeper clean, try using a baking soda solution. Simply mix one part baking soda with two parts water, pour it into the bin, and let it sit for at least an hour. Then, wash it thoroughly with a brush and rinse well.

Don't forget to air your bin after cleaning. Leave the lid open for a few hours or place it in the sun check here to help kill any remaining bacteria and odors. You can also sprinkle some activated charcoal at the bottom of the bin to absorb any lingering smells.

By following these simple tips, you can keep your bin clean, odor-free, and ready for anything.

Prevent Bin Germs From Winning: Sanitation Practices for Your Waste Container

Your waste container is more than just a place to throw your rubbish. It's also a breeding ground for bacteria if you're not careful. To keep those pesky illnesses at bay, follow these simple tips for maintaining a clean and sanitary bin.

  • Regularly empty your bin to prevent accumulation of waste.
  • Use a trash bag liner to make disinfecting easier.
  • Scrub the inside and outside of your bin with detergent solution at least once a week.
  • Consider using an odor-eliminating spray or powder to keep things fresh.
  • Keep your bin in a well-ventilated area away from food and heat sources.
